Step-by-Step Guide to Paying Attention

 

ChatGPT,

Please generate a step-by-step guide to paying attention based on [Epictetus, Discourses, 4.12].


"ChatGPT"

"Step-by-Step Guide to Paying Attention:

1. Understand the consequences: Recognize that when you relax your attention and fail to pay attention to important matters, it leads to negative outcomes. Realize that this habit of not paying attention can escalate into deferring attention and procrastinating on living a fulfilling life in accordance with nature.

2. Reflect on the value of attention: Understand that paying attention is essential for accomplishing tasks effectively and for engaging in a meaningful and satisfactory life. Realize that being inattentive generally leads to poorer outcomes in various aspects of life.

3. Examine the impact of inattention: Acknowledge that when your mind wanders and you lack focus, you lose the ability to make choices aligned with virtues like seemliness, self-respect, and moderation. Understand that succumbing to impulsive desires and following inclinations without attention can be detrimental.

4. Identify areas requiring attention: Determine the specific areas of your life that demand your attention. Start with general principles that guide your actions, such as recognizing that you are responsible for your moral purpose and that your well-being depends solely on your choices. Acknowledge that external factors or others cannot control your happiness or virtue.

5. Embrace personal responsibility: Internalize the idea that you alone have authority over yourself in matters of good and evil. Recognize that external circumstances or the opinions of others should not disturb you if you have secured your inner principles and moral purpose.

6. 
Prioritize self-approval: Shift your focus from seeking approval from others to aiming to please and submit to a higher power or your own understanding of what is morally right. Understand that God has entrusted you with the responsibility of managing your moral purpose and that aligning with virtuous standards is more important than the opinions of those who oppose them.


7. Recognize the need for training: Understand that perturbation caused by criticism or censure arises from a lack of training in handling such situations. Realize that it is natural for every science or skill to despise ignorance and that mastery in any field requires consistent effort and learning.

8. Internalize the guiding principles: Make it a habit to have the general principles and guiding concepts readily available in your mind. Let them govern your thoughts, decisions, and actions throughout the day. Understand that these principles provide a framework for your conduct and help you navigate social interactions effectively.

9. Be mindful of your actions: Constantly remind yourself of your identity and role, and strive to align your actions with your responsibilities and social obligations. Consider appropriate timing for activities like singing, playing, and engaging in social interactions. Avoid behaving in a manner that invites contempt from others and undermines your self-respect.

10. Recognize the consequences of deviation: Understand that deviating from the principles and neglecting attention in any aspect of life will result in negative consequences. Realize that the loss or harm incurred is not imposed by external forces but stems from the nature of the activity itself.

11. Aim for improvement: Accept that achieving perfection and being completely free from faults is unrealistic. However, commit to a continuous effort to avoid faults by maintaining attention and vigilance. Understand that even avoiding a few mistakes can contribute significantly to personal growth and success.

12. Value the present moment: Reject the tendency to postpone paying attention. Realize that by delaying your commitment to attention, you are allowing negative traits and behaviors to dominate your present self. Understand that if paying attention is valuable tomorrow, it is even more valuable today. Embrace the importance of being attentive now to create a foundation for future success."
